Output 7d998adbf51a17d252dd68b6809e87b6ae6c6c63ec6df347dc91d7adb2004763:0

value
1057956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 306245338a869f1303f63c5843de5756b6916cc5 OP_EQUAL
address
366r5h9UK6TtWiW3ns2FncS2qNB8rZm1Dz
transaction
7d998adbf51a17d252dd68b6809e87b6ae6c6c63ec6df347dc91d7adb2004763
spent
true